Open Access Journal: Dispute Resolution Review

Did you know that Bond University publishes a number of Open Access Journals?

Today you are being introduced to the Law Faculty's Dispute Resolution Review (DRR) by one of its Chief Editors, Rachael Field.

The recently launched DRR is an international and interdisciplinary journal with a broad focus covering all aspects of dispute resolution theory and practice. 

The DRR is published under the auspices of the Law Faculty’s Dispute Resolution Centre.

Articles from the DRR’s predecessor, the ADR Bulletin, which ceased publication in 2012, are available online in the Library's Open Educational Resources Collection.
